On 16.08.25 08:40, Fabian Grünbichler wrote:
> the question how to (potentially) handle Rust crate backporting for
> Trixie came up in the Debian Rust team recently, and we would like to
> have your input!
>
> some background information that might be relevant:
> - Rust executables need to be statically linked
> - there is no stable ABI for linking
> - as a result, Rust "library" packages actually contain source code
> - Rust dependency trees are (quite a bit) larger then C/.. ones
>
> in practice this means that for backporting an application (or shared
> library for consumption via a C-compatible interface) there are two
> options:
>
> A) backport everything
> [...]
>
> B) vendoring
> [...]

If you ask me, I'd like to ask you to follow approach A.

Rationale: In the end this is a challenge inherited from the rust eco 
system and how it is packaged in Debian. So, making *any* piece of 
software available in a Debian release means all the crates it needs 
during build need to get packaged first. This is a decision that was 
made when uploading things to unstable, and the Debian backports suites 
are not the place to change that approach. If you want to change the 
approach, I'd kindly ask you to change the approach in unstable/testing 
first.
